Labour market intermediaries’ role tells us…?

Hat tip Economist View for Vox EU David Autor. Though heterogeneous, it is my contention that labour market intermediaries serve a common role. They address – and in some case exploit – a set of endemic departures of labour market operation from the first-best benchmark of full information, perfect competition, and decentralised price taking. Arctic sea ice notice

A simple analysis of Arctic sea ice can be found here. A cooler early season provided a cushion for a warmer late season temperature pattern, resulting in more first year ice retention than in 2007. Different wind patterns made for a larger dispersal area than last year.
